Stone masonry repair services involve the restoration and preservation of existing stone structures to maintain their integrity and appearance. These services typically include cleaning, repointing mortar joints, replacing damaged or deteriorated stones, and stabilizing foundations or walls. Skilled professionals assess the condition of the stonework to identify issues such as cracks, erosion, or loose stones, then perform targeted repairs to address these problems and extend the lifespan of the structure.

This type of repair work helps resolve common problems associated with aging or weathered stone structures. Over time, exposure to the elements can cause mortar joints to weaken, stones to crack or crumble, and structural stability to diminish. Repair services can prevent further deterioration, reduce the risk of collapse or damage, and restore the aesthetic appeal of the property. Proper stone masonry repair can also help maintain the value of a property by preserving its historical or architectural significance.

Properties that frequently utilize stone masonry repair services include historic buildings, residential homes with stone facades, retaining walls, and commercial structures featuring stone elements. These structures often require ongoing maintenance to address the effects of weathering, settling, or accidental damage. Stone masonry repair is also common for restoring monuments, public landmarks, and other culturally significant structures that demand careful preservation and structural integrity.

Labor Costs - Masonry repair services typically range from $45 to $85 per hour, depending on the complexity of the work and local rates. For small repairs, labor may total $200 to $500, while larger projects can cost over $1,500 just for labor.

Material Expenses - The cost of materials such as stone, mortar, and sealants usually falls between $10 and $50 per square foot. An average repair project might require $300 to $1,200 worth of materials, depending on the extent of damage.

Project Size and Scope - Minor repairs like repointing or crack filling can cost as little as $500 to $1,500, whereas extensive restoration or rebuilding may range from $3,000 to $10,000 or more. The overall cost is influenced by the size and complexity of the masonry work.

Additional Factors - Factors such as accessibility, the condition of existing masonry, and local labor rates can affect costs. Extra services like cleaning or sealing might add $200 to $800 to the total cost of stone masonry repair services.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of stone masonry repair services are available? Local service providers offer a range of repairs including crack filling, joint restoration, surface cleaning, and structural stabilization to address various stone masonry issues.

How can I tell if my stonework needs repair? Signs such as cracking, chipping, loose stones, or deterioration of mortar joints may indicate the need for professional stone masonry repair services.

What are common causes of stone masonry damage? Damage often results from weathering, settling, moisture infiltration, or physical impact, which can compromise the integrity of stone structures.

How long does stone masonry repair typically take? Repair durations vary depending on the extent of damage and the scope of work, with some projects completing within a few days and others requiring more time.
